Output e512cb105da061000388f5829010fe4a81f242b70f91ae36b1602bd4d4785edf:5

value
1991
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 66a0c93a962e136ad5d2cc1c377fa790f3cad164f50faabf3ebffc919f414877
address
bc1pv6svjw5k9cfk44wjeswrwla8jreu45ty758640e7hl7fr86pfpms873892
transaction
e512cb105da061000388f5829010fe4a81f242b70f91ae36b1602bd4d4785edf
spent
true